Questions & Answers about Har du adaptern till datorn?
Why do we use till here instead of saying datorns adapter?
While datorns adapter is understood, Swedish heavily prefers using till to show that one object is a physical accessory or part of another. When using this structure, notice that both nouns must be in the definite form: adaptern till datorn.
English says "for the computer", but doesn't till usually mean "to"?
Yes, till is most commonly learned as "to" indicating direction. However, in Swedish, till is the standard preposition to express this kind of belonging or matching relationship between two physical objects. English translates this as "for" or "to" depending on the noun, such as the adapter for the computer or the key to the door.
Why is the definite form adaptern and not adapteren?
Adapter is an en-word. When an en-word ends in an unstressed -er, the -e- usually drops out before adding the definite ending -en to make it easier to pronounce. So adapter becomes adaptern.
I sometimes hear Swedish speakers say data. Is that the same as en dator?
They are related but different. En dator refers to the physical machine, and its definite form is datorn (the computer). The word data refers to information, statistics, or the general subject of IT and computing.
